if someone is selling you stuff from canada and telling you they can't send it via traceable packaging, they are lying. i ship via canada post but make the buyer pay the extra for a tracking number (this info is in the auction)--have done this successfully to the usa, uk, australia and finland. the cost is standard shipping for whatever size package you have PLUS C$9 (about us$5.50) to send something registered, which means it's trackable and requires a signature. insurance is included (up to $200 and $1 extra for each additional $100). canada post's tracking web site can be accessed here.

if you paid by paypal of billpoint, you should be able to cancel the payment (assuming the seller did not give you the option to get the package tracked or insured and you declined).
if you paid by check, the seller probably waited for it to clear (this is normal). if you paid by money order you can check if it's been cashed.
regardless of how you paid, if the seller is not responding to your emails, i would recommend attempting cancelling the payment NOW. if the package arrives, it is very easy to cancel the cancellation. (much easier than cancelling a payment after waiting too long.)
i don't recommend EVER buying anything of value on ebay from someone with zero feedback unless you pay by paypal or billpoint and maybe not even then.
finally, your package may still arrive. it's possible it's been held at the border/customs. however, i would still recommend putting the wheels in motion to cancel that payment.
(for the record, if i send something via Air to the usa it takes, usually, less than 7 days (sometimes as quick as 4). if i send via ground, it'll take 15 or so days max, not counting customs delays. how much did you pay for shipping? of course, none of this takes into consideration the time wasted waiting for a payment to clear prior to shipping.)
